Crumpsall Lane is in Manchester and in Manchester district. M8 5FB is located in the Crumpsall elect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Blackley and Broughton. This postcode has been in use since 1994-05-01.

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ding M8 5FB has a slightly higher male population, with 50.4%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 45% | 49.6% | 4.6% | 51.0% | -1.4% |
| Male | 55% | 50.4% | -4.6% | 49.0% | 1.4% |

In this area, the population is more ethnically diverse compared to the UK average. While 41.1% of the residents identify as white, which is lower than the UK average of 81.4%, there are significant representations of other ethnic groups.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Bangladeshi | 0% | 0.6% | 0.6% | 1.1% | -0.5% |
| Chinese | 0.5% | 0% | -0.5% | 0.7% | -0.7% |
| Indian | 5.5% | 4.1% | -1.4% | 3.1% | 1.0% |
| Pakistani | 18.2% | 25.5% | 7.3% | 2.7% | 22.8% |
| Other Asian | 7.3% | 4.5% | -2.8% | 1.6% | 2.9% |
| Black African | 3.1% | 10.1% | 7.0% | 2.5% | 7.6% |
| Black Caribbean | 0.9% | 0.9% | 0.0% | 1.0% | -0.1% |
| Other Black | 1.4% | 0.6% | -0.8% | 0.5% | 0.1% |
| Mixed White and Asian | 1.9% | 0.6% | -1.3% | 0.8% | -0.2% |
| Mixed White and African | 0.5% | 0.6% | 0.1% | 0.4% | 0.2% |
| Mixed White and Caribbean | 2.8% | 2.8% | 0.0% | 0.9% | 1.9% |
| Mixed Other | 0.9% | 1.5% | 0.6% | 0.8% | 0.7% |
| White | 50.5% | 41.1% | -9.4% | 81.4% | -40.3% |
| Arab | 4.3% | 4.1% | -0.2% | 0.6% | 3.5% |
| Other | 2.1% | 3% | 0.9% | 1.6% | 1.4% |
